Living Room: Warm, Inviting, and Balanced
The living room is where people gather, relax, and unwind. Scents here should feel welcoming without overwhelming the space.
Best candle scent types for living rooms:
Warm florals
Soft woods
Light amber blends
Subtle vanilla or musk
These fragrances create a cozy, layered ambiance that works for everyday living and entertaining.

Bedroom: Calm, Soft, and Restful
Bedrooms benefit most from calming, soothing scents that encourage rest and relaxation.
Best candle scent types for bedrooms:
Lavender and soft florals
Powdery or creamy notes
Light musk
Gentle herbal blends
Avoid overly strong or energizing fragrances in this space. The goal is tranquility, not stimulation.
Create a Nighttime Ritual: Light your bedroom candle 30–60 minutes before winding down, then extinguish before sleep to enjoy the lingering scent.
Bathroom: Clean, Fresh, and Airy
Bathrooms are ideal for fresh, crisp scents that make the space feel clean and spa-like.
Best candle scent types for bathrooms:
Fresh florals
Light citrus
Clean linen-style scents
Subtle herbal notes
Smaller spaces benefit from lighter fragrances that refresh without overpowering.

Kitchen: Subtle and Complementary
Kitchen candles should neutralize odors without competing with food aromas.
Best candle scent types for kitchens:
Light citrus
Soft herbal notes
Clean, neutral scents
Avoid heavy gourmand or overly sweet scents while cooking, as they can clash with food smells.
Pro Tip: Light kitchen candles after cooking for a fresh, inviting reset.
Home Office: Focused and Refreshing
Scents in a home office should promote clarity and productivity without distraction.
Best candle scent types for offices:
Soft florals
Light citrus
Clean, fresh blends
These fragrances help create an intentional workspace while maintaining a calm environment.
Entryway: Memorable First Impressions
Your entryway sets the tone for your entire home. A well-chosen candle scent creates an instant sense of welcome.
Best candle scent types for entryways:
Balanced florals
Soft woods
Clean, warm blends
This is the perfect place to showcase a signature scent that reflects your style.
